Abstract
To securely hold occupants without interruption during breakage caused by collision using each ECU in a system configuration based on a motorized seatbelt retractor having an ECU combined with a motor in which harness length along which many currents flow is made short.
A main ECU and a subsidiary ECU each have functions corresponding to those are provided to a control unit for controlling a motor for a motorized seatbelt retractor, the main ECU determines output start conditions and transmits commands, and the subsidiary ECU autonomously performs detailed motor current control and the like.
